Ticket: Turnstile counter rejecting firmware update

Gatearray units at the Pellman Arena refused the 2.4 firmware — signature verification fails on boot. Cause: build pipeline signed with the retired key after last month's rotation; units only trust the current one. Re-sign the artifact and redeploy. Do not bypass verification on the units. Current signing key for the pipeline is below.

signing key of bagap-yawep = bky13_TbfT6ZMUoGJo2

### Key Ceremony Checklist — Item 7: TurnCount Recovery Seed

Welcome aboard! During the ceremony for the Valmere Arena turnstile counter (TurnCount), you'll witness the signing of the gate-tally root key. Don't stress — your only job at this step is to confirm the sealed envelope matches what's read aloud. Once the officiant finishes, the counter service gets re-initialized and the old seed is destroyed. New folks often ask where the fallback lives: it's kept right here in this record, appended immediately after this sentence.

unlock words, hahip-baduf: holwyn-istath-julvan

Ticket: Crashfall ingest failing on staging

New folks, please read carefully. The Pebblekit mobile app's crash reports aren't reaching the symbolication queue because staging's env file was copied without its upload credential. Symptoms: 401s in the collector logs every five minutes. To fix, add the missing line to the env file, exactly as follows.

secret setting of fafop-tagep: VAULT_KEY29=6a815d21e2d77cc25ef1802d73ee6